The Role of a House Window Installer: Expertise in Transformation
Windows serve a fundamental role in a home, combining visual appeals, energy efficiency, and functionality. The importance of professional installation can not be understated, as it affects the performance and durability of the windows. In this article, we explore the responsibilities, abilities, and factors to consider involved in employing a house window installer, providing a comprehensive introduction of this necessary profession.
Understanding the House Window Installer
A house window installer is a skilled tradesperson accountable for getting rid of old windows and installing new ones. They ensure that windows are secure, practical, and carry out efficiently. The job needs more than just physical labor; it demands a deep understanding of building and construction methods, building codes, and energy effectiveness.
Responsibilities of a House Window Installer
Evaluation and Measurements
- An extensive examination of existing window conditions.
- Accurate measurements to ensure a proper suitable for brand-new windows.
Window Selection Guidance
- Providing suggestions on various types of windows: single-hung, double-hung, moving, bay, and casement.
- Talking about energy-efficient choices, such as double or triple glazing and Low-E coatings.
Elimination of Old Windows
- Securely dismantling and disposing of old window systems without harming the surrounding structure.
Installation of New Windows
- Preparing openings to satisfy maker requirements and local codes.
- Properly sealing and insulating brand-new windows to improve energy performance and aesthetic appeals.
Last Adjustments and Testing
- Guaranteeing that windows open, close, and lock correctly.
- Performing final inspections to guarantee the stability of the installation.
Cleanup and Disposal
- Clearing the workspace and eliminating any debris from old installations.
Abilities Required for House Window Installers
House window installers must have a particular set of skills to guarantee quality work:
- Technical Proficiency: Understanding of different window types and installation techniques.
- Attention to Detail: Precision in measurements and installation treatments.
- Physical Dexterity: Ability to deal with tools and materials securely.
- Issue Solving: Addressing unexpected problems that might arise throughout installation.
- Customer Service: Communicating effectively with customers to comprehend their needs and educate them about the installation procedure.
Advantages of Hiring a Professional Window Installer
Employing a professional window installer can supply various advantages, including:
- Expertise: Licensed professionals have the understanding and experience essential to ensure optimum efficiency of set up windows.
- Time Savings: A skilled installer can typically complete the task more rapidly than an inexperienced property owner.
- Quality Assurance: Reputable installers generally provide guarantees on their workmanship, offering comfort.
- Compliance with Codes: Professionals are skilled in local building codes, decreasing the risk of legal or safety concerns.
Factors to Consider When Hiring a House Window Installer
When choosing a window installation professional, consider the list below elements:
- Experience and Qualifications: Look for installers with extensive experience and legitimate licenses or certifications.
- Recommendations and Reviews: Check online evaluations and ask for references to evaluate the quality of work.
- Insurance: Ensure the installer carries liability insurance coverage to secure versus accidents or damage.
- Guarantee: Inquire about service warranties on both labor and windows.
- Cost Estimates: Obtain multiple quotes to ensure you're getting a reasonable rate.

FAQs About House Window Installation
1. How long does it take to set up new windows?
The period of the installation procedure can vary based upon the variety of windows, the type of installation, and weather. On average, it can take anywhere from a couple of hours to a couple of days to finish the job.
2. Do I require to be home during the installation?
While it isn't mandatory for property owners to be present, it is advisable. Being home enables instant communication regarding options, modifications, or questions that may arise during the procedure.
3. Will window installation damage my walls?
Professional window installers take required precautions to decrease any damage. Nevertheless, some small touch-ups may be necessary post-installation.
4. Can window installers assist with window upkeep after installation?
Many installers use upkeep services or recommendations on how to care for your new windows to optimize their lifespan and effectiveness.

5. What kinds of windows can I pick from?
There are a number of kinds of windows, including:
- Double-hung windows
- Moving windows
- Casement windows
- Awning windows
- Bay and bow windows
- Image windows
